Transaction 07584a85b1326acf027125621110c87b911a0a1d41b0900961838a9b58898391

1 Input
2 Outputs
  • 07584a85b1326acf027125621110c87b911a0a1d41b0900961838a9b58898391:0
  • value  1918259
    address  3EDQg1fjk68yfjhNfLRR6M588ZdLgsBCTV
  • 07584a85b1326acf027125621110c87b911a0a1d41b0900961838a9b58898391:1
  • value  7922242
    address  38hRgetXZT3sDmhaJffbecdpNbqJWkbpNA